
Security threats are one of the biggest issues that keep tech leaders up at night. Keeping your systems safe and secure is an ongoing battle, and it’s a battle most companies fear they will lose. According to recent data, only 26 percent of IT leaders feel that their departments are well-equipped to handle security threats…. Read more »